IZI acquires Cook Medical's spine assets — 5 takeaways

Spinal Tech
Adam Schrag -

IZI Medical Products acquired Cook Medical's vertebroplasty product portfolio.

Here are five things to know:

 

1. The products are marketed under Duro-Jectm Osteo Site, Osteo-Force and Vertefix brands.

 

2. Products in the portfolio treat vertebral compression fractures through a minimally invasive approach.

 

3. IZI will partner with neuro-interventional radiologist Kieran J. Murphy, MD, of the University of Toronto as part of the acquisition.

 

4. IZI is Shore Capital Partners' interventional products platform.

 

5. Michael Shaffer will serve as chief financial officer of IZI.

 

IZI Medical CEO Greg Groenke said, "Cook has done an excellent job establishing these products as reliable, high-quality solutions for treating vertebral compression fractures and we have enjoyed working with them on this transaction."
